Cyclothymia Explained Part I



One type of mental health challenge is a form of bipolar disorder, which is milder than BP D but as troubling to those who battle it.  It is known as Cyclothymia or Cyclothymic Mood Disorder (CMD). I was diagnosed with this in 2006 after coming out of a very toxic relationship with a mentor.  Not only had I been attracting these types of abusive people, but I fought to remain in unhealthy relationships due to CMD.  On this video, I discuss the basics about CMD and will share from experiences and research about the disorder. It's not hopeless if you have this problem, it's only hopeless if you don't seek treatment. Enjoy the information on this series and thanks so much for watching.
